              Background
              Associates with IFNAR1 to form the type I interferon receptor. Receptor for interferons alpha and beta. Involved in IFN-mediated STAT1, STAT2 and STAT3 activation(PubMed:26424569). Isoform 1 and isoform 2 are directly involved in signal transduction due t
